KARACHI: Police on Tuesday identified a constable who gunned down an unarmed youth Abrar at Sindhi Muslim Housing Society last night.
Constable Kalimullah from the Counter Terrorism Department gunned down Abrar.
The cops accused of the murder said that they had spotted a suspicious car near Lucky Star and followed it.
When the car reached Sindhi Muslim Housing Society Kalimullah opened fire at him, initial statement with the recorded with the police stated.
The policemen were scared when they found out at that Abrar and Dilnawaz, who was driving the car, were unarmed, they said.
They fled before the area police arrived at the crime scene.
Police has confiscated weapons of the accused policemen.
Early Monday morning unidentified policemen gunned down Abrar and injured Dilawar who was driving.
According to details, Abrar Hussain and Dilnawaz were trying to close a mobile phone deal when Dilnawaz drove away his car without paying. Abrar hung on to the car as it sped on, eye witnesses said.
A police mobile crossing by opened fire at the car killing Abrar and injuring Dilnawaz, eye witnesses added.
The two, Abrar and Dilnawaz, had met each other through an online portal for selling phones.
Jinnah Hospital Medico-legal officer Dr Shehzad said that Abrar had been shot thrice.
A Geo News reporter who visited the crime scene said that the Dilnawazâs car had been shot at several time. The car was riddled with about 30 bullets, he said.
Abrarâs family protested against the murder.
